Average Information Security Analysts Salary in Salem, OR

The average salary for a Information Security Analysts in Salem, OR is $139,490. This compensation is in line with national standards, reflecting a balanced and stable local job market.

Executive Summary

  • Average Salary: $139,490 per year.
  • Growth Trend: Salaries have shifted 46.2% over the last 5 years.
  • Top Earners: Senior professionals (90th percentile) earn up to $209,235.
  • Outlook: The current demand for Information Security Analystss is stable, with a local workforce of approximately 190 professionals. This role remains a specialized component of the broader Salem, OR economy.

Information Security Analysts Salary Distribution in Salem, OR

The earning potential for Information Security Analystss in Salem, OR varies significantly by experience level. The salary gap is relatively narrow, suggesting consistent and predictable earnings from entry-level to senior positions. Entry-level roles (10th percentile) typically start around $91,140, while highly experienced professionals can command wages upwards of $209,235.

Salem, OR has 0.85x the national average concentration of Information Security Analysts jobs. This means there are fewer opportunities per capita here compared to the U.S. average — competition for roles may be higher.

190 people work as Information Security Analysts in Salem, OR.

Only 0.993 out of every 1,000 local jobs are Information Security Analysts roles — this is a niche profession in the area.

Methodology: Salary data is derived from the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) OEWS 2024 release. Figures represent gross pay before taxes. Analysis includes 190 employees in the Salem, OR area with a job density of 0.993 per 1,000 jobs. Cost of Living data is estimated based on state and metro averages.
